Red Epic shoots Esquire’s Sexiest Woman Alive 2009

Matt Jeppsen | 09/11

Teaser image and video from the 2009 convergence shoot

image

The photographer that previously used a Red One camera to shoot Megan Fox earlier this year for Esquire’s Sexiest Woman Alive 2008 has upped the ante for 2009. The crew at Red provided an early production camera from the new Epic line for the 2009 shoot, and Esquire has leaked a mysterious framegrab and short video clip. So I guess that means Red might actually ship a new camera this year! Sweet.

The video clip is embedded below. For technical evaluation purposes only, of course. Enjoy.
